Zero public transport stops serve Johnsons Hill, leaving the area with no regular transit options. This means residents rely entirely on private vehicles to get around, as there are no bus or train services available within the locality.

Public transport access

Stops, services, routes and how far you can get by public transport.

With no routes or stops and zero weekly departures, public transport access is far below the Queensland figure. This lack of service is much lower than the state average of 2.99 stops per 1,000 people.
